Some studies have shown that high calcium intake from dairy products … WebMar 23, 2024 · This can cause excessive thirst and frequent urination. Digestive system. Hypercalcemia can cause stomach upset, nausea, vomiting and constipation. Bones and muscles. In most cases, the excess calcium in your blood was leached from your bones, which weakens them. This can cause bone pain and muscle weakness. Brain.

WebHere are some easy guidelines for selecting foods high in calcium: Dairy products have the highest calcium content. Dairy products include milk, yogurt and cheese. A cup (8 ounces) of milk contains 300 mg of calcium. The calcium content is the same for skim, low fat and whole milk. Dark green, leafy vegetables contain high amounts of calcium. WebDec 1, 2024 · 5. Collard Greens: 21% DV. This vegetable packs a boatload of vitamins A, C, B6, iron and magnesium — and it just happens to be one of the best non-dairy foods high in calcium. One cup of cooked collard greens has 267.9 milligrams or 21 percent of your DV.
